Output 33f009fd17386e4e9b76e49037c54a56255411792ef7de05a1b6d0ba2cbc2370:7

value
157092234
script pubkey
OP_0 OP_PUSHBYTES_20 4b7d7515e94e323e53290c335babe0dffcd93362
address
tb1qfd7h290ffceru5efpse4h2lqml7djvmzh6um28
transaction
33f009fd17386e4e9b76e49037c54a56255411792ef7de05a1b6d0ba2cbc2370
confirmations
132816
spent
true